Dealing With Insurance Companies After a Car Accident

Navigating the insurance landscape after a car accident can be daunting. Insurance companies often have their interests in mind. Understanding how to effectively deal with them is vital for ensuring a fair settlement.

Initially, it’s important to notify your insurance company promptly. Delay in reporting can complicate your claim. However, be cautious about what you disclose.

Providing too much detail early on can hurt your case. Stick to basic facts initially, such as the date and location of the accident. Avoid admitting fault or discussing your injuries in detail.

Insurance adjusters will likely contact you soon after. They may seem helpful but remember their goal is to minimize payouts. Having an attorney to communicate with them on your behalf is beneficial.

Insurance 101

Here are some tips for dealing with insurance companies:

  • Notify your insurer promptly
  • Stick to basic facts when reporting the accident
  • Avoid signing any release or agreement without legal advice
  • Consider having an attorney handle communication with adjusters
  • Review all settlement offers with legal counsel before accepting

What If the At-Fault Driver Is Uninsured or Underinsured?

Facing an uninsured or underinsured driver complicates car accident claims. However, options for compensation still exist. It’s important to know your rights and potential avenues for recovery.

First, review your auto insurance policy. Many policies include uninsured/underinsured motorist (UM/UIM) coverage. This can provide compensation when the at-fault driver lacks adequate insurance.

If UM/UIM coverage is available, it can cover medical expenses, lost wages, and other damages. This policy feature is crucial in protecting your financial interests.

Here’s what to consider if the at-fault driver is uninsured or underinsured:

  • Check your policy for UM/UIM coverage
  • Consider pursuing a personal injury lawsuit for additional recovery
  • Consult with an attorney to explore all legal options

Statute of Limitations for Car Accident Claims in Georgia

In Georgia, the statute of limitations for car accident claims is two years. This time limit begins on the date of the accident. It is essential to act within this period to preserve your legal rights.

Failing to file a lawsuit within two years may forfeit your ability to seek compensation. This statutory deadline is strictly enforced by Georgia courts. It is crucial to consult with an Atlanta injury lawyer promptly after an accident.

A personal injury lawyer typically works on a contingency fee basis, which means they only get paid if they successfully recover money for you. Here’s how it works:

  1. No Upfront Fees: When you hire a personal injury lawyer, you don’t have to pay anything out of pocket to get your case started. There are no upfront costs or fees required to begin working on your case. This allows you to pursue legal action without worrying about immediate expenses.
  2. Contingency Fee Agreement: The lawyer agrees to take a percentage of the settlement or court award you receive if your case is successful. This percentage is agreed upon in advance and is typically outlined in a written agreement. If the lawyer doesn’t win your case, you don’t owe them any legal fees.
  3. No Recovery, No Fee: If your case doesn’t result in a settlement or court award, the lawyer doesn’t get paid. This means the lawyer is motivated to work hard on your case and maximize your compensation, as their payment depends on your success.
  4. Costs and Expenses: While you don’t pay upfront fees, there may still be case-related expenses, such as court filing fees, expert witness fees, or costs for obtaining medical records. Some lawyers cover these costs during the case and deduct them from your settlement or award at the end. Others may ask you to pay these costs if the case is unsuccessful, so it’s important to clarify this with your lawyer upfront.

In summary, a personal injury lawyer’s payment structure is designed to make legal representation accessible to everyone, regardless of their financial situation. You don’t have to pay a dime to start your case, and the lawyer only gets paid if you win. This arrangement aligns the lawyer’s interests with yours, ensuring they are committed to achieving the best possible outcome for your case.

The value of a personal injury case depends on several factors, and without specific details, it’s impossible to provide an exact amount. However, here are the key factors that influence the worth of a personal injury case:

1. Medical Expenses

  • Current and future medical bills related to the injury.
  • Costs of surgeries, medications, physical therapy, and other treatments.

2. Lost Wages and Earning Capacity

  • Income lost due to time off work during recovery.
  • Reduced earning capacity if the injury affects your ability to work in the future.

3. Pain and Suffering

  • Compensation for physical pain, emotional distress, and mental anguish caused by the injury.
  • This is subjective and varies case by case.

4. Property Damage

  • If the injury involved damage to personal property (e.g., car accident), the cost of repairs or replacement.

5. Severity and Long-Term Impact

  • Permanent disabilities, scarring, or disfigurement increase the value of a case.
  • Long-term or chronic pain also impacts the settlement.

6. Liability and Negligence

  • Clear evidence of the other party’s fault strengthens your case.
  • If you’re partially at fault, your compensation may be reduced (depending on your state’s laws).

7. Insurance Policies

  • The at-fault party’s insurance coverage could affect the amount you recover.
  • Other factors to consider are punitive damages and jury outcomes which could significantly increase the value of your case.

8. Jurisdiction

  • Some areas are known for higher or lower compensation amounts based on local laws and jury tendencies.

9. Settlement vs. Trial

  • Settlements are often lower than jury awards but avoid the risk of losing at trial.

The time it takes to resolve a personal injury case can vary widely depending on several factors, including the complexity of the case, the severity of the injuries, the willingness of the parties to negotiate, and the court’s schedule. Here are some general timelines:

  1. Settlement Negotiations: Many personal injury cases are resolved through settlement negotiations without going to trial. This process can take anywhere from a few months to a year or more, depending on how quickly both parties can agree on terms.
  2. Filing a Lawsuit: If a settlement cannot be reached, the next step is to file a lawsuit. The filing process itself is relatively quick, but the subsequent legal proceedings can take much longer.
  3. Discovery Phase: After a lawsuit is filed, both parties enter the discovery phase, where they gather evidence, take depositions, and exchange information. This phase can last several months to a year or more.
  4. Pre-Trial Motions and Mediation: Before going to trial, there may be pre-trial motions and mediation attempts to resolve the case. This can add several months to the timeline.
  5. Trial: If the case goes to trial, the trial itself might last a few days to several weeks. However, getting a trial date can take a year or more due to court backlogs.
  6. Post-Trial Motions and Appeals: If either party is dissatisfied with the trial outcome, they may file post-trial motions or appeals, which can extend the resolution time by several months to a few years.

Factors That Can Affect the Timeline:

  • Severity of Injuries: Cases involving severe or long-term injuries may take longer to resolve because the full extent of the damages may not be immediately clear.
  • Disputes Over Liability: If fault is contested, the case may take longer to resolve.
  • Multiple Parties: Cases involving multiple defendants or plaintiffs can be more complex and time-consuming.
  • Court Backlogs: The availability of judges and courtrooms can impact how quickly a case moves forward.

What You Can Do:

  • Stay in Communication: Keep in regular contact with your attorney to stay updated on the progress of your case.
  • Be Patient: Personal injury cases can be lengthy, but a thorough approach often leads to a better outcome.
  • Follow Medical Advice: Continue to follow your doctor’s recommendations and keep detailed records of your treatment and recovery.
